Background:
• The PNLC Learning Center consolidates the wealth of information on coastal and ocean
governance, improves public access to this information, promotes awareness and replication of
exemplary practices in coastal governance, and generally promotes a culture of learning and
knowledge sharing.• The need to establish and strengthen PEMSEA learning centers is based upon two certainties: a)
there is a significant amount of intellectual capital in the region that remains untapped in the
drive to achieve sustainable development; and b) capacities to address the priority management
issues/concerns are disparate among and within countries of the region, and in certain
programme areas, are inadequate.• The overall objective of establishing PEMSEA learning centers is to serve as PEMSEA’s technical
support mechanism in the implementation of programs within the framework of the SDS-SEA.
The learning centers will ensure the region’s access to expert services and advice as well as providing support and assistance in project management and implementation relating to SDS-
SEA implementation.• Research institutions and universities are expected to provide a strong support to PEMSEA in
promoting the replication and scaling up of ICM efforts, linking it with other area-based
management approaches and in implementing the joint regional strategy ‘Sustainable
Development Strategy for the Seas of East Asia (SDS-SEA). Thus, strengthening their capacity on
SDS-SEA programs specifically in integrated coastal management and other management
approaches, the promotion of blue economy and related activities is critical.PNLC Proceedings General Assembly 2024

Introduction:
The 2024 PNLC Executive Committee (PNLC EC) Meeting was organized by the PEMSEA Resource
Facility (PRF), which is currently serving as the interim PNLC Secretariat, on 22 July 2024 in Puerto
Princesa, Palawan, Philippines. It was organized as a back-to-back activity with the 16
th EAS
Partnership Council Meeting and the Blue Carbon Working Group Meeting. It was participated in byProf. Yonvitner of the Center for Coastal and Marine Resources Studies of the IPB University (CCMRS-
IPB) and President of the PNLC, Dr. Fang Qinhua, Deputy Director of the Coastal and OceanManagement Institute of Xiamen University (COMI-XU) and Vice-President of the PNLC, and Ms.
Aimee T. Gonzales, PEMSEA Resource Facility (PRF) Executive Director as members of the PNLC
Executive Committee. Ms. Isdahartatie and Dr. Gentha Akmal of the CCMRS-IPB University/incoming
PNLC Secretariat and Ms. Maida Aguinaldo, PEMSEA Training and Capacity Development Manager
served as the Secretariat of the meeting.PNLC Proceedings General Assembly 2023

Introduction:
The 2023 PNLC Executive Committee (PNLC EC) Meeting was organized by the PEMSEA Resource
Facility (PRF), which is currently serving as the interim PNLC Secretariat, on 27 July 2023 in Hanoi,
Vietnam. It was organized as a back-to-back activity with the 15th EAS Partnership Council Meeting. It
was participated in by Prof. Yonvitner of the Center for Coastal and Marine Resources Studies of the
IPB University (CCMRS-IPB) and President of the PNLC, Dr. Fang Qinhua, Deputy Director of the Coastal
and Ocean Management Institute of Xiamen University (COMI-XU) and Vice-President of the PNLC,
and Ms. Aimee T. Gonzales, PEMSEA Resource Facility (PRF) Executive Director as members of the
PNLC Executive Committee. Ms. Isdahartatie of the CCMRS-IPB University/incoming PNLC Secretariat
and Ms. Nancy Bermas from PRF attended the meeting which was chaired by Prof. Yonvitner. Ms.
Maida Aguinaldo, PEMSEA Training and Capacity Development Manager served as the Secretariat of
the meeting.PNLC Code of Conduct

Purpose:
This document was established in line with Article 5, Paragraphs 4-5 of the PNLC
Charter, mandating the creation of a Code of Conduct that will provide standards for
professional conduct in every major field of operation of the PNLC to guide the smooth
and efficient operations of the network in implementing the Sustainable Development
Strategy for the Seas of East Asia (SDS-SEA). It was patterned, with appropriate
amendments, after the Code of Ethics for PRF Personnel and the codes of conduct of
several associations and universities. The PNLC Code of Conduct was approved by the
General Assembly on 10 September 2022.
